Blue Trust Inc. Boosts Holdings in Regions Financial Corporation $RF

Blue Trust Inc. increased its stake in shares of Regions Financial Corporation (NYSE:RFFree Report) by 15.1% in the second qu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 11,059 shares of the bank’s stock after buying an additional 1,454 shares during the period. Blue Trust Inc.’s holdings in Regions Financial were worth $260,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About Regions Financial

Regions Financial Corporation, a financial holding company, provides banking and bank-related services to individual and corporate customers. It operates through three segments: Corporate Bank, Consumer Bank, and Wealth Management. The Corporate Bank segment offers commercial banking services, such as commercial and industrial, commercial real estate, and investor real estate lending; equipment lease financing; deposit products; and securities underwriting and placement, loan syndication and placement, foreign exchange, derivatives, merger and acquisition, and other advisory services.
